Jamey Sharp
4c64375e91 nixos/nscd: delete redundant nscd.conf options
These options were being set to the same value as the defaults that are
hardcoded in nscd. Delete them so it's clear which settings are actually
important for NixOS.

One exception is `threads 1`, which is different from the built-in
default of 4. However, both values are equivalent because nscd forces
the number of threads to be at least as many as the number of kinds of
databases it supports, which is 5.

Jamey Sharp
de251704d6 nixos/nscd: run with a dynamic user
nscd doesn't create any files outside of /run/nscd unless the nscd.conf
"persistent" option is used, which we don't do by default. Therefore it
doesn't matter what UID/GID we run this service as, so long as it isn't
shared with any other running processes.

/run/nscd does need to be owned by the same UID that the service is
running as, but systemd takes care of that for us thanks to the
RuntimeDirectory directive.

If someone wants to turn on the "persistent" option, they need to
manually configure users.users.nscd and systemd.tmpfiles.rules so that
/var/db/nscd is owned by the same user that nscd runs as.

In an all-defaults boot.isContainer configuration of NixOS, this removes
the only user which did not have a pre-assigned UID.

Jamey Sharp
597563d248 nixos/nscd: let systemd manage directories
Previously this module created both /var/db/nscd and /run/nscd using
shell commands in a preStart script. Note that both of these paths are
hard-coded in the nscd source. (Well, the latter is actually
/var/run/nscd but /var/run is a symlink to /run so it works out the
same.)

/var/db/nscd is only used if the nscd.conf "persistent" option is turned
on for one or more databases, which it is not in our default config
file. I'm not even sure persistent mode can work under systemd, since
`nscd --shutdown` is not synchronous so systemd will always
unceremoniously kill nscd without reliably giving it time to mark the
databases as unused. Nonetheless, if someone wants to use that option,
they can ensure the directory exists using systemd.tmpfiles.rules.

systemd can create /run/nscd for us with the RuntimeDirectory directive,
with the added benefit of causing systemd to delete the directory on
service stop or restart. The default value of RuntimeDirectoryMode is
755, the same as the mode which this module was using before.

I don't think the `rm -f /run/nscd/nscd.pid` was necessary after NixOS
switched to systemd and used its PIDFile directive, because systemd
deletes the specified file after the service stops, and because the file
can't persist across reboots since /run is a tmpfs. Even if the file
still exists when nscd starts, it's only a problem if the pid it
contains has been reused by another process, which is unlikely. Anyway,
this change makes that deletion even less necessary, because now systemd
deletes the entire /run/nscd directory when the service stops.

Jamey Sharp
93f185df65 nixos/nscd: no longer need to wait for readiness
This postStart step was introduced on 2014-04-24 with the comment that
"Nscd forks into the background before it's ready to accept
connections."

However, that was fixed upstream almost two months earlier, on
2014-03-03, with the comment that "This, along with setting the nscd
service type to forking in its systemd configuration file, allows
systemd to be certain that the nscd service is ready and is accepting
connections."

The fix was released several months later in glibc 2.20, which was
merged in NixOS sometime before 15.09, so it certainly should be safe to
remove this workaround by now.
